The iPhone rumor mill
2017 is the tenth anniversary of the iPhone; therefore, pundits are expecting significant changes to the existing design. The original iPhone was announced in 2007 where, on January 9, Steve Jobs announced to the world that his company was transforming the iPod, revolutionizing the mobile phone, as well as developing a unique internet device. Experts assumed that Jobs was talking about three different products; however, he stunned the world. He was announcing the first iPhone.
Consequently, every year Apple fans wait excitedly for the announcement of the latest iPhone. Rob Price of the UK Business Insider notes that even though we are still about six months away from the launch of the iPhone 8, the rumor mill is already buzzing with excitement.
While keeping in mind that these are just rumors and that Apple has not made any formal announcements, here are a few of the stories about the latest iPhone that are swirling around:
Screen size

It is anticipated that the next iPhone will have an edge-to-edge screen with curved edges. Apple will reduce the size of the bevels around the screen to allow for a bigger screen. In other words, Apple will be able to fit an iPhone 7 Plus-sized screen on an iPhone 7-sized body. Furthermore, it is believed that Apple will deviate from the use of its traditional LCD screens and install the latest OLED technology on its new smartphone.
Augmented reality
There are reports that Apple is considering adding augmented reality functionality as part of the new iPhone’s default offering. This rumor is believed to have some substance because the Apple CEO has made it known that he is enamored with the technology that makes augmented reality possible.
iPhone camera
Leaked photos of potential iPhone 8 developmental units show that Apple is changing the design of the back of the iPhone. Allegedly the iPhone 7 Plus dual-lens design is back; however, the camera lenses are installed vertically instead of horizontally.
